Residential Lawn Seeding in Ventura County, CA
Residential lawn seeding services involve the process of planting new grass seed to establish a healthy, lush lawn. This service is commonly requested for projects such as repairing bare patches, thickening thin or uneven areas, or starting fresh on a new property. Homeowners often seek lawn seeding to improve curb appeal, enhance outdoor spaces for recreation, or prepare for seasonal changes. Before requesting lawn seeding, property owners should consider the type of grass suitable for their climate, the current condition of their soil, and any specific maintenance requirements to ensure successful growth.
It is important for property owners to understand the different seeding methods available, such as traditional broadcast seeding or specialized techniques like slit seeding, and how each may impact the results. Clarifying the desired lawn appearance, timing for planting, and ongoing care needs can help determine the most effective approach. Additionally, knowing the extent of the area to be seeded and any existing landscaping features can assist in planning a successful project that promotes a healthy, durable lawn.

Common Residential Lawn Seeding Jobs
Residential Lawn Seeding - Enhances the density and overall health of existing lawns.
Patch Repair - Replaces thin or bare spots to promote even growth.
New Lawn Establishment - Prepares and seeds bare or newly cleared areas for a lush finish.
Overseeding - Improves lawn color and thickness by adding new grass seed to mature turf.
Soil Preparation - Ensures proper seed contact and nutrient availability for successful germination.
Erosion Control - Stabilizes slopes and bare areas to prevent soil loss and promote healthy growth.
Residential Lawn Seeding Questions
What is lawn seeding? Lawn seeding involves spreading grass seed to establish or improve a healthy, dense lawn surface.
When is the best time for seeding? The optimal time for seeding is during the cooler months of spring or early fall for best germination.
What types of grass are suitable for seeding? Common options include cool-season grasses like fescue and Kentucky bluegrass, suitable for residential lawns.
How does seeding improve a lawn? Seeding helps fill in bare spots, thickens existing grass, and enhances overall lawn appearance and health.
